    Unhappy richo 1224c network card

    hi all

    m new here and this is my first post i have problem with richo aficio 1224c i hope i will find solution here

    ihave a richo aficio color copier there was no network card in it i install a network card in it and got the interface setting tab in system setting
    but when i try to enter IP address m fail to do. when i press the ip address tab on screen nothing happend but just beep beep twice.

    can anyone help me how toconfigure network card

    Cobiray is correct. You stated that you installed the network card but did you also install the DIMM (two of them) for Printer and for NIB/Scanner? With this box you can't simply put a network card in it, you have to "unlock" the functionality via the DIMM's

    YEP, you need the print scanner Dimm, and extra 256Mb PC100 memory Dimm. any old laptop memory Dimm will do the job perfectly.

    Plus, in order to enter the IP address, you have to take it out of DHCP by pressing "SPECIFY" first. Just my 2 cents, Paul.
